EFFECTS OF ECCENTRICITY OF THE PARENT BODY ON MULTI-TETHERED SATELLITE FORMATIONS

This paper discusses the relevance of eccentric reference orbits on the dynamics of a tethered formation, when a massive cable model is included in the analysis of a multitethered satellite formation. The formations examined in this study are Hub-And-Spoke (HAS) and Closed-Hub-And-Spoke (CHAS) configurations for in-plane and Earth-facing spin planes. A stability analysis is performed, together with the evaluation of the effects of eccentricity on tether elongation, agents relative position, and formation orientation and shape. The possible presence of periodic solutions is also investigated.
